Both the uncertified 'expert' from Kenya, David Ayu Nyango
Njoga and former aviation minister Osita Chidoka miserably failed to establish
the existence of the server allegedly used by the Independent National
Electoral Commission for the transmission of election results during the last
general elections.

Njoga, who claimed to be an Information Technology (ICT)
expert from Kenya, said he was engaged by the petitioners to analyse results of
the election as obtained from INEC server and stored in a
website:"https://www.factsdontlieng.com/.ÔÇØ

When asked whether INEC owns the website, the witness said
no, but that the data it contains are from INEC server.

Njoga, claimed that the website:
"https://www.factsdontlieng.com/ÔÇØ is owned by an INEC official, who provided
the election result figures. When asked to name the said INEC official, the
witness said: "My lord, the INEC official is anonymous and I do not know him.ÔÇØ

Under cross-examination by the leader of Buhari's legal
team, Chief Wole Olanipekun (SAN), Njoka said the website was created on March
12, 2019. When reminded that the presidential election held on February 23 and
the results released before March 12, the witness went blank.
